The Real Folk Blues

by Howlin' Wolf

The Real Folk Blues cover art

Assembled by Chess Records to capitalize on the burgeoning 1960s folk and blues revival, this release compiles some of Howlin' Wolf's most ferociously electric recordings from the previous decade. The collection heavily features the towering, abrasive vocals of Chester Burnett colliding with Hubert Sumlin's razor-sharp guitar lines, many penned by Willie Dixon. It served as a massive, direct inspiration for the British rhythm and blues invasion.
